The Okinawan Tonfa is a melee weapon in the World of Assassination Trilogy, based off of a traditional Okinawan-style tonfa.


Description[]

"A blunt weapon. Made of traditional red oak wood. Can be used in melee or thrown to knock an individual unconscious."
― In-game Description

Perks[]

Icon-Melee
Non-Lethal Melee Knocks targets unconscious in close combat.
Icon-Melee
Non-Lethal Throw Knocks targets unconscious at range.

Trivia[]

  • An unusable Okinawan Tonfa can be found during The Splitter, on the ground near the door in the dojo area.
